Abstract
Human N-acetylglucosaminyltransferase-III (GnT-III) has not been hitherto p urified from either tissue or cell line. Although rat GnT-III has been puri fied from rat kidney tissue, the procedure involves laborious and complex s teps. We have developed a simplified procedure based on a QAE (diethyl[2-hy droxypropyl]aminoethyl)-Sepharose and an immunoaffinity chromatography tech nique. The immunoaffinity chromatography utilized a monoclonal antibody to human aglycosyl recombinant N-acetylglucosaminyltransferase-III. With the n ew procedure, human N-acetylglucosaminyltransferase-III was purified from h epatocellular carcinoma tissues with an increase in the specific enzyme act ivity of 378-fold.
